Sukau Pgrs Denies Mass Defection Claim
It says the allegation is baseless and a 'political fantasy'.
Sukau PGRS secretary Emerson Dawang said fewer than 10 individuals have actually left the party. (Facebook pic)KOTA KINABALU: The Sukau division of Parti Gagasan Rakyat Sabah (PGRS) has dismissed claims that more than 2,000 of its members have quit the party, calling the allegation baseless, defamatory and a “political fantasy”
Its secretary, Emerson Dawang, said an internal check found that fewer than 10 members had left the party.
He also noted that several individuals cited in the allegation were in fact new members who were previously with Parti Warisan and only followed former Sukau PGRS women’s chief Dayang Norhayati Titing when she joined Barisan Nasional.
“Dayang Norhayati has long been inactive at the division level, and the branch she led is also inactive,” he said in a statement here today.
Emerson described her claim of a 2,000-member exodus as cheap political provocation aimed at portraying Sukau PGRS as being in crisis, which he said was far from the truth.
He said the division strongly rejected the allegation and took a serious view of attempts to tarnish the party’s image through the spread of false information.
He also said that PGRS Sukau remained stable and organised, and continued to grow with rising membership.
“The PGRS machinery in the Sukau state constituency is on standby and strengthening campaigns for the state election,” he added.
The Election Commission has set Nov 29 as polling day for the 17th Sabah state election, with early voting on Nov 25. - FMT
